Handover note — Crumbwheel order cutoffs.

Welcome aboard. The bakery cutoff rule in Crumbwheel closes same-day orders at 14:00 local to each storefront, not UTC — this has bitten us twice. Holiday overrides live in the calendar service and take precedence silently, so always check there first when a cutoff looks wrong. To unlock the calendar service's admin console after a restart, enter the recovery passphrase below.

vault phrase of bagap-bahaf = silion-pelox-sorox-casdor-quenwyn-fraax-eliox-praael-kelion-quenvan-kasox-rusael-norius-belvan

Handover note — Feldgate to Marrow. Department heads: the possible acquisition of Quarrystone Labs is live. Diligence half done; their Pinefold product overlaps ours less than feared. Valuation gap remains. Keep teams out of speculation; no outreach to Quarrystone staff. Marrow owns this from Monday. The confidential deal position is set out immediately below.

confidential, kagep-kahof: Druokax Systems plans to lower the Ulaath list price by 53 percent in March.

To the release manager: I'm passing ownership of the Pellwick deep-link router to Sorrel before the 4.2 cut. The intent-matching table now lives in the Farrowgate config service; stale entries were purged last sprint. Watch the fallback route — it silently swallows malformed slugs, which inflated our drop-off metrics in March. The staging resolver needs its keystore unlocked before each regression pass, and that keystore accepts only one credential. For the signing vault, the recovery phrase is noted directly below.

recovery phrase for tafog-fafog: novix-novdor-fraath-brieth-olieth-oliix-rusix-wenion-julax-druox